Cement Sack Transport: Truck Vs. Small Commercial Vehicle

Carrying cement sacks efficiently and effectively is crucial in the construction industry. However, choosing between a truck and a small commercial vehicle can significantly impact project timelines and costs. This article aims to assess the advantages and disadvantages of each option, considering factors such as capacity, manoeuvrability, price, and suitability for construction purposes. We can determine the optimal solution for transporting cement sacks during construction projects by examining these factors.

Which One Is The Best Truck or a Small Commercial Vehicle?

1. Capacity And Load-Bearing Capacity

Trucks and small commercial vehicles differ in cargo capacity, a critical factor when transporting cement sacks. Trucks typically offer larger cargo capacities, allowing for transporting a higher quantity of cement sacks in a single trip. This advantage reduces the journeys required, enhancing efficiency and saving time. In contrast, SCVs have a limited cargo space, which may require multiple trips to transport the same volume of cement sacks as a truck.

However, it is critical to see if the load-bearing capacity of the vehicle is equally crucial. While trucks generally have higher load-bearing powers, SCVs can still handle substantial loads, depending on their design and specifications. Therefore, a small commercial vehicle may suffice for smaller construction projects requiring fewer cement sacks. In addition, delivering the cement sack to a location with accessibility can also use small commercial vehicles.

2. Manoeuvrability And Accessibility

Manoeuvrability 1. and accessibility are significant considerations when choosing a vehicle for carrying cement sacks on construction sites. Small commercial vehicles such as the Mahindra Treo Zor can manoeuvre more easily than larger ones because of their small size. As a result, they can go through congested regions, cramped building sites, and narrow streets with less risk of accidents and more operating effectiveness.

On the other hand, trucks often struggle with manoeuvrability due to their larger size. As a result, they may face challenges accessing construction sites with limited space or restricted entry points. Manoeuvring a truck in tight spaces can be time-consuming and may require additional assistance or specialised equipment. However, trucks are better suited for large-scale construction projects with ample space for efficiently manoeuvring and unloading cement sacks.

3. Cost Considerations

Cost is crucial in determining the best option for carrying cement sacks in construction. Trucks generally cost more upfront than small commercial vehicles due to their larger size and load capacity. Additionally, maintenance and fuel costs for trucks are typically higher. However, when considering the larger cargo capacity and reduced number of trips required, trucks may be cost-effective in terms of labour cost, time consumption, and fuel efficiency over the long run.

Small commercial vehicles, with their smaller size and lower initial cost, maybe a more economical choice for smaller construction projects with fewer cement sack requirements. They have lower maintenance and fuel costs and may be easier to operate and maintain. However, the trade-off is the increased number of trips necessary to transport the desired quantity of cement sacks, potentially leading to higher labour costs and project delays.

4. Suitability For Construction Purposes

The suitability of a vehicle for carrying cement sacks in construction depends on the specific project requirements. Trucks such as Ashok Leyland Truck are highly suitable for large-scale construction sites with ample space, where a significant volume of cement sacks needs to be transported efficiently. Their larger cargo capacity and higher load-bearing capabilities enable the transport of materials in a single trip. Additionally, minimising delays and improving project timelines.

On the other hand, small commercial vehicles are better suited for smaller construction projects or locations with limited accessibility. Their manoeuvrability and compact size allow them to navigate tight spaces and congested areas, making them ideal for urban construction sites or projects with restricted entry points. In addition, while they may require more trips to transport the same quantity of cement sacks as a truck, they offer flexibility in accessing confined areas.

Furthermore, the suitability of the vehicle also depends on the type of construction material being transported. For example, cement sacks are relatively heavy, but trucks and small commercial vehicles can accommodate them. However, if the construction project involves transporting other bulky or oversized materials in addition to cement sacks, a truck with its larger cargo space may be a more practical choice.

5. Safety And Regulations

Ensuring safety during transportation is paramount in the construction industry. Both trucks and small commercial vehicles must adhere to safety regulations and load-bearing limits set by transportation authorities. Trucks can generally handle heavy loads and have reinforced frames and suspension systems to ensure stability while carrying substantial cargo.

Although not designed for heavy-duty loads like trucks, small commercial vehicles can still comply with safety regulations for transporting cement sacks within their load-bearing limits. It is important to consider the vehicle's payload capacity and distribute the cement sacks' weight evenly to maintain stability during transit.

Conclusion

In conclusion, the choice between a truck and a small commercial vehicle for constructing cement sacks depends on various factors. These factors include project size and accessibility to cost, and manoeuvrability requirements. Trucks offer larger cargo capacities and higher load-bearing capabilities, making them suitable for larger construction projects with ample space. On the other hand, small commercial vehicles excel in manoeuvrability, particularly in congested areas or tight construction sites. Therefore, they are more cost-effective for smaller projects with limited cement sack requirements. Ultimately, the selection should align with the specific needs of the construction project to ensure efficient transportation and timely completion.
